A stunning best bitter which evokes a taste of an old English woodland, with shafts of dappled sunlight striking through green cedar trees.
Flintlock will ignite your tastebuds with its spicy orange undertones and just a hint of marmalade.

Gravity dispense at EBF XVI, 07/11/13. Clear golden with a thin off white covering. Nose is bready, orange, summer fruit, light caramel. Taste comprises bread dough, hint of citric fruit, orange, grassy. Medium bodied, moderate carbonation, light bitter notes in the closure. Whelming bitter!
